    First experience at Zippys last night fir dinner and we really enjoyed it. We ordered at the counter and chose to eat in. We chose a Zip Pack Deluxe which includes chili, mac salad with golden fried chicken, crispy breaded white flaky fish filet, tender teriyaki marinated beef, and Spam®, on a bed of rice topped with classic Japanese takuan pickled radish and furikake seasoning ($18.60) and also ordered a mini Loco Moco- An iconic Hawaii dish invented by hungry Hilo teenagers. A juicy hamburger patty atop a bed of rice, smothered with brown gravy and topped with two eggs. Served with mac salad($11.30). We shared both entrees and if this sounds like a huge amount of food…it is. The Zip Pack Deluxe we could have shared without ordering anything else and we would have left quite full. The fish and chicken were really good and the teriyaki beef was a little chewy but good flavor. The macaroni salad is really good and the chili tasted great too. The Loco Moco was probably our favorite dish. The brown gravy with the rice and hamburger Patty were very tasty and reminded us of Salisbury steak we used to eat at home. We will definitely order this dish again and we chose to have our eggs scrambled. We will return to Zippys and can recommend it if you are visiting and there is one neat by. We wanted to try a local restaurant and this one is a good one to experience. It appears that they have a table service section too. We didn’t realize this until after we ordered at the counter.

    Zippy's is a Hawaiian institution, so if you are visiting you should try it at least once. There are many Hawaiian favorites on the menu, but our favorite was the Korean chicken. It comes in chunks of breaded style chicken covered with a slightly sweet sauce that is delicious. Rice and macaroni salad are the staple sides. Finish your meal with a yummy slice of custard pie. The staff was friendly. Covid precautions include putting your name in with contact tracing info via QR code for being seated at a table, masks required for staff and those not seated/eating, and temp checks prior to entry.
